Transaction f376313eaf18b89eb2b64fe67815883d68f9e96bb13807585e8036fbc5288962
1 Input
2 Outputs
- f376313eaf18b89eb2b64fe67815883d68f9e96bb13807585e8036fbc5288962:0
- f376313eaf18b89eb2b64fe67815883d68f9e96bb13807585e8036fbc5288962:1
value 640000
address 1C1273SRSpUzNhucyQk4FXCs5ioR1M3nfJ
value 40430335
address 3JKrW5G65rf9ok2a241GQkzEwws49ut2Ad